www.abg000.net
导读:
在现代化软件开发中,API已成为促进不同软件间交互和数据共享的关键桥梁,为了优化API的开发、测试及文档化流程,众多工具和技术应运而生,本文将深入探讨Phalcon和Swagger这两个工具的结合使用,以构建高效的API文档与开发环境。...
在现代化软件开发中,API已成为促进不同软件间交互和数据共享的关键桥梁,为了优化API的开发、测试及文档化流程,众多工具和技术应运而生,本文将深入探讨Phalcon和Swagger这两个工具的结合使用,以构建高效的API文档与开发环境。

Phalcon是一个高性能的PHP框架,它凭借丰富的功能和工具,助力开发者快速构建高效且安全的Web应用程序,其简洁性和高效性使得Phalcon成为开发API的优选,利用Phalcon,开发者可以轻松地处理请求和响应,实现身份验证和授权等核心功能。
Swagger:API文档化与自动化的规范工具
Swagger是一种用于API文档化和自动化的规范工具,使开发者能够以清晰、一致的方式描述API的结构和功能,通过Swagger,开发者可以生成易于理解的API文档,这些文档详细描述了API的端点、请求参数、响应格式等信息,除此之外,Swagger还能自动生成API的测试代码和客户端SDK,从而极大地简化了API的开发和测试流程。
Phalcon与Swagger的完美结合
将Phalcon与Swagger集成在一起,能够实现API开发的高效性与文档化的完美结合,通过集成Phalcon和Swagger,开发者在开发过程中可以自动生成API文档,并在Swagger UI中直接测试API的端点,这种集成还有助于开发者在开发过程中发现和解决潜在问题,从而提高API的质量和稳定性。
实施步骤
- 在Phalcon项目中安装Swagger集成库。
- 根据Phalcon项目的API结构和功能配置Swagger。
- 利用Swagger UI生成直观的API文档,为开发者和用户提供清晰的界面展示。
- 通过Swagger自动生成测试代码和客户端SDK,这些工具将极大地简化API的测试和开发流程。
- 在开发过程中持续优化和调整Swagger的配置,确保API文档的准确性和质量。
Phalcon与Swagger的集成是构建高效API文档与开发环境的理想选择,通过将这两个工具结合使用,开发者可以充分利用Phalcon的强大功能和Swagger的自动化能力,提高API的开发效率、质量和稳定性,这种集成不仅使API的文档化流程更加简化,还使得API的测试和开发变得更加便捷和高效,为开发者带来前所未有的开发体验。




